The Apple iPhone 8 Plus is a little bit better than Samsung Galaxy A8 Star, with a general score of 87.1 against 82.1. The Apple iPhone 8 Plus design has the same thickness than Samsung Galaxy A8 Star, but it is a bit heavier. The Apple iPhone 8 Plus counts with a bit sharper screen than Samsung Galaxy A8 Star, because although it has a little worse 1080 x 1920 resolution and a little bit smaller display, it also counts with a bit better count of pixels per display inch.
Apple iPhone 8 Plus has a little faster processing unit than Samsung Galaxy A8 Star, because although it has 3 GB lesser RAM memory and a lower number of cores (although they are faster), it also counts with a 64 bits CPU. IPhone 8 Plus has a greater storage capacity to store more games and applications than Samsung Galaxy A8 Star, because although it has no slot for external memory cards, it also counts with more internal storage.
The Galaxy A8 Star features a really longer battery performance than Apple iPhone 8 Plus, because it has a 37 percent larger battery capacity. IPhone 8 Plus has a little bit better camera than Galaxy A8 Star, although it has a tinier camera aperture which is worse for low light images and videos, a smaller back camera sensor which gives a worse image and video quality, a worse 3840x2160 (4K) video quality and a way less MP resolution camera in the back.
